Height

When selecting a bedside crib, choose one that can be adjusted to the ideal height for you. It must also be able of being dropped down to allow you to lift your baby up towards you for night feeds or soothing. This is particularly useful when you are recovering from a C section. For instance the Next2me and Tutti Bambini cots can be adjusted up to a height of 58cm while the Snuzpod 3 goes up to 63cm and the Knuma Huddle up to 70cm.

You should also consider the level you would like the base of your crib to be. While some mums find it easier to lift their children out of standard Moses baskets at the lowest height, others prefer a higher base to give them more stability. Safety

A large bedside cot's main safety feature is that it is able to be raised or lowered so parents can reach their child to feed or comfort him or their nappy. This means that it's ideal for mothers who are still recovering from a C-section. You should look for an option that allows you to lower the sides of the bed with a single button press. This will allow you to raise your child without having to get out of the bed. This is crucial, particularly as your child grows and becomes more mobile. Do not add anything that may increase the risk of injury or suffocation, such as pillowcases and duvets that can cause your baby to overheat.

The CPSC's NPR included 24 incidents that were attributed to product problems like gaps between the bedside sleeper and the adult bed (12 incidents) Fabric-side enclosed openings (11 incidents) as well as consumer misassembly, or missing parts (6 incidents); and miscellaneous other product-related issues (9 incidents).

In its NPR the CPSC examined the possibility of introducing additional requirements to bedside crib and travel cot sleepers. For example they would need to meet the minimum height requirements for bassinets, or at the very least, the maximum height requirements for the lowered rail. However the CPSC found that these requirements would not be practical or effective in reducing the number of incidents where infants were entrapped between the bedside sleeper and an adult bed.

The majority of the reported incidents in the NPR included bedside baby bed sleepers with multiple uses that could be converted into other types of use, such as bassinets and play yards. Many commenters suggested that the CPSC add a second option to the proposed rule for bedside sleepers that are multi-use that would allow them to meet the minimum side height requirements for bassinets by using an attachment that can be removed. The attachment can be permanently connected or removed when the item is not being used as a bassinet for babies.

The CPSC is considering these and other comments that were received in response to its NPR on bedside sleepers.
